预计到 2034 年,电动拖拉机市场规模将从 2025 年的 19.6 亿美元成长至 180.8 亿美元,2026 年至 2034 年的复合年增长率为 28.01%。

受永续和高效耕作方式需求不断增长的推动,电动拖拉机市场预计将显着增长。与传统柴油拖拉机相比,电动拖拉机具有诸多优势,包括减少排放气体、降低营运成本和降低噪音。随着农业部门转向采用更环保的技术并提高永续性,对电动拖拉机的需求预计将会增加。在环境法规日益严格、农民寻求减少碳足迹的地区,这一趋势尤其明显。

此外,农业领域对技术创新的日益关注正对电动拖拉机市场产生积极影响。智慧技术的集成,例如精密农业工具和自动驾驶功能,正在提升电动拖拉机的功能性和效率。随着农民利用技术优化作业、提高生产力,对创新电动拖拉机解决方案的需求预计将会增加,这为製造商提供了产品差异化的机会。

此外,电池技术的进步正在塑造电动拖拉机市场的未来前景。储能解决方案的创新正在提升电动拖拉机的续航里程和性能,拓展其在各种农业应用中的实用性。快速充电基础设施的建设也在稳步推进,使农民能够快速且有效率地为电动拖拉机充电。随着研发不断探索电动拖拉机在新应用领域的潜力,在对永续和高性能农业解决方案的需求驱动下,市场预计将迎来显着成长。

The Electric Tractor Market size is expected to reach USD 18.08 Billion in 2034 from USD 1.96 Billion (2025) growing at a CAGR of 28.01% during 2026-2034.

The electric tractor market is poised for significant growth, driven by the increasing demand for sustainable and efficient agricultural practices. Electric tractors offer several advantages over traditional diesel-powered tractors, including reduced emissions, lower operating costs, and quieter operation. As the agricultural sector seeks to adopt greener technologies and improve sustainability, the demand for electric tractors is expected to rise. This trend is particularly evident in regions where environmental regulations are becoming more stringent and farmers are looking for ways to reduce their carbon footprint.

Moreover, the growing emphasis on technological advancements in agriculture is positively influencing the electric tractor market. The integration of smart technologies, such as precision farming tools and autonomous driving capabilities, is enhancing the functionality and efficiency of electric tractors. As farmers seek to leverage technology to optimize their operations and improve productivity, the demand for innovative electric tractor solutions is likely to increase, providing opportunities for manufacturers to differentiate their offerings.

Additionally, advancements in battery technology are shaping the future of the electric tractor market. Innovations in energy storage solutions are enhancing the range and performance of electric tractors, making them more viable for various agricultural applications. The development of fast-charging infrastructure is also gaining traction, allowing farmers to recharge their electric tractors quickly and efficiently. As research continues to explore the potential of electric tractors in new applications, the market is expected to witness significant growth, driven by the need for sustainable and high-performance agricultural solutions.
